WebSep 26, 2024 · Carbamazepine, phenobarbital, phenytoin, and primidone have evidence of efficacy for generalized-onset tonic–clonic seizures but may also worsen certain generalized seizure types. Eslicarbazepine, gabapentin, oxcarbazepine, tiagabine, and vigabatrin also have the potential to worsen certain generalized seizure types.

WebThe first-line treatment is administered when a tonic-clonic or focal motor clonic seizure has lasted five minutes (impending or premonitory CSE). Second-line treatment is administered when the CSE has persisted after two doses of a first-line treatment (established CSE). WebPhenytoin (Dilantin): Used for treatment of tonic-clonic seizures and complex partial seizures. Phenytoin will enter breast milk and cross the placenta. Common side effects include ataxia, hypotension, diplopia, nausea and gingival hyperplasia. WebSome drugs (eg, phenytoin, valproate), given IV or orally, reach the targeted therapeutic range very rapidly. Others (eg, lamotrigine, topiramate) must be started at a relatively low dose and gradually increased over several weeks to the standard therapeutic dose, based on the patient’s lean body mass.
